In our factory, the first step in turning raw materials into good fabrics is to prepare the yarn.
Before the yarn is woven, it is first put on a layer of "protective clothing" (this is called sizing) so that it is not easily broken when the machine is running quickly.
Then, workers will very carefully thread these yarns one by one and arrange them neatly (this is called threading), so that the woven cloth can be stylish and not scattered.
After the yarn is ready, it enters the core "transformation" link - loading the loom.
No matter what kind of advanced machines they are, they repeat three key actions:
1.Opening: First separate the yarn lengthwise to leave a gap.
2.Weft insertion: quickly pass the transverse yarn through this gap.
3.Beating up: push the horizontal thread through tightly and collide with the vertical thread.
In this way, the horizontal and vertical yarns are intertwined vertically and become pieces of "gray cloth". This is what we often call "white gray cloth". It is the original appearance of the cloth, and all subsequent dyeing and processing must be based on it.
